?What is Left Kidney Length?

Left kidney length is a structural measurement of the left kidney obtained via ultrasound or imaging, typically ranging from 9–13 cm in adults. This measurement helps assess kidney size and detect potential structural abnormalities. Kidney dimensions can vary based on age, body surface area, and individual anatomy.

!Why It Matters

Abnormal left kidney length may suggest chronic kidney disease, acute kidney injury, hydronephrosis, or other renal pathologies. Changes in kidney size can be associated with infection, obstruction, or systemic conditions affecting renal function. Regular monitoring may help track kidney health and detect progressive organ changes.

When to Test

Testing is recommended when there is a family history of kidney disease, persistent hypertension, diabetes, recurrent kidney infections, or symptoms suggestive of renal pathology. Routine screening may also be appropriate for individuals with chronic conditions affecting kidney health.
